Todd is a novelist and poet who's read and performed his work across ihe West, on the East Coast, and in Berlin, Germany.

Author of two books of poetry, Wire Song, Conundrum Press, 2001, and Tamped, But Loose Enough to Breathe, Ghost Road Press, 2008.

Co-author (with wife, Kym O'Connell-Todd) of The Silverville Saga Series, including Little Greed Men, All Plucked Up, and The Magicke Outhouse, all from Raspberry Creek Books.

His science fiction novel, Strange Attractors, was released in October, 2012.

His latest work, also co-authored with Kym, is Wild West Ghosts, a nonfiction book on haunted hotels in Colorado.

Mark Todd Writer's block is fundamentally a fear of failure. I've always loved Natalie Goldberg's advice from WRITING DOWN THE BONES on this score: Give yourself permission to fail sometimes. Writing is drafting and revising -- developing characters, redirecting plots, rearranging words and then chsnging or adding new ones. Don't put so much pressure on yourself. Let ideas and stories unfold and listen to the words.(less)
